CHÂTEAU FLEUR CARDINALE

Saint Emilion Grand Cru

Surface area : 18 ha.
Density : 7,000 to 6,200 trunks/ha.
Average age of the vineyard : 35 to 40 years.
Soil and sub-soil : Argilo-calcareous on a rocky base with chalky concretions.
Plantation : 70% Merlot.
15 % Cabernet Franc.
15% Cabernet Sauvignon.
Harvesting : Hand picking using small crates.
Temperature control : Internal by runoff.
Duration of tank fermentation : 3 to 4 weeks.
Ageing : 100% new barrels.
Duration of ageing : 16 to 20 months.

CHÂTEAU BOIS CARDINAL

Saint Emilion

CHATEAU BOIS CARDINAL, the property's second wine, is made with the same care and attention shown to our number one wine CHATEAU FLEUR CARDINALE.
Formed partly from young vines and wine presses, CHATEAU BOIS CARDINAL is aged in new and one year old barrels.
This garnet and crimson-coloured Grand Cru with a fresh fruit bouquet and a hint of undergrowth, requires two to three years to fully mature.
